Read on to discover the top programming languages for ai development in 2026 and take your career to the next level.

The Future of AI Development

As artificial intelligence continues to transform industries and revolutionize the way we live and work, the choice of programming language is crucial for developers seeking to excel in this rapidly evolving field.

Rune DevlinOpen Source & Dev CultureMay 28, 20264 min readโšก Llama 4 Scout

The AI revolution is in full swing, and the demand for skilled developers who can harness the power of artificial intelligence is skyrocketing. As we hurtle into 2026, the programming language landscape is evolving rapidly, with new contenders emerging and established players vying for dominance. But which languages are best suited for AI development? In this article, we'll dive into the top programming languages for AI development, exploring their strengths, weaknesses, and real-world applications.

The Rise of Python: Unchallenged King of AI?

Python has long been the de facto standard for AI development, and its popularity shows no signs of waning. With a vast array of libraries and frameworks, including TensorFlow, Keras, and PyTorch, Python has become the go-to language for machine learning and deep learning applications. Its simplicity, flexibility, and extensive community support make it an ideal choice for developers of all levels.

"Python is the language of choice for AI and machine learning because it's easy to learn, easy to use, and has a massive community of developers who contribute to its ecosystem." - Guido van Rossum, Creator of Python

Python's dominance in AI is reflected in its adoption by top tech companies. For instance, Google uses Python extensively in its AI and machine learning initiatives, including TensorFlow and Google Cloud AI Platform. Similarly, Facebook relies on Python for its AI-powered services, such as Facebook AI and Messenger.

Rise of the New Contenders: Julia and Rust

While Python remains the top dog, new contenders are emerging to challenge its dominance. Julia, a high-performance language developed at MIT, is gaining traction in the AI community. Its multiple dispatch feature allows for more flexible and efficient coding, making it an attractive choice for high-performance AI applications.

Another rising star is Rust, a systems programming language that's gaining popularity in the AI space. Its focus on memory safety and performance makes it an attractive choice for building AI-powered systems that require low-level optimization.

"Julia is designed to be fast, efficient, and easy to use, making it an ideal choice for AI and machine learning applications." - Viral Shah, Co-Founder of Julia Computing

The Veteran: Java's Resurgence in AI

Java, a veteran programming language, is experiencing a resurgence in AI development. Its platform independence, strong ecosystem, and extensive libraries make it a viable choice for building AI-powered applications. The Weka library, for instance, provides a comprehensive set of tools for machine learning and data mining in Java.

Java's adoption in AI is driven by its widespread use in enterprise environments. Companies like IBM and Oracle rely on Java for their AI-powered solutions, including IBM Watson and Oracle AI Cloud.

The Dark Horse: Lisp's Revival in AI Research

Lisp, a language with a rich history in AI research, is experiencing a revival of sorts. Its macro system and functional programming features make it an attractive choice for building AI systems that require flexibility and customization.

The Common Lisp dialect, in particular, has seen a resurgence in AI research, with projects like CLClojure and Rosetta gaining traction. Lisp's influence can also be seen in modern languages like Clojure and Scala, which borrow heavily from its functional programming paradigm.

Conclusion: The Future of AI Development

As we look ahead to the future of AI development, it's clear that Python will continue to play a dominant role. However, new contenders like Julia and Rust are poised to challenge its dominance, while veteran languages like Java and Lisp experience a resurgence in popularity. Ultimately, the choice of programming language will depend on the specific needs of the project, and developers would do well to stay informed about the latest trends and advancements in the AI landscape.

As the AI revolution continues to unfold, one thing is certain: the demand for skilled developers who can harness the power of AI will only continue to grow. Whether you're a seasoned pro or just starting out, now is an exciting time to join the AI revolution and shape the future of technology.

/// EOF ///
๐Ÿ”“
Rune Devlin
Open Source & Dev Culture โ€” CodersU